1637 shaares
145 liens privés
145 liens privés
Un petit article expliquant comment récupérer une base ayant InnoDb de planté.
Pas très très compliqué...mais toujours chiant de récupérer des commandes qu'on n'utilise jamais.
Pour ma part, j'ai l'impression que :
- innodb_force_recovery=1 m'a corrigé les erreurs(et pas =3).
- J'ai ensuite viré tout ce qui était "ibdata1" et "ib_logfile0 et 1" dans le /var/lib/mysql
Enfin par défaut les log mysql sont dans le syslog...pas pratique. Pour remédier à cela il faut utiliser la commande ci-dessous pour lancer le service mysql :
mysqld_safe --skip-syslog --log-error=/root/log.txt